As a breed I personally like Pit Bulls.

When properly raised, when pack structure has been established, when they have been obedience trained and socialized they are great family pets. Unfortunately there are many people in our society who ignore these very important responsibilities and the results are often catastrophic. This article is intended as a warning to Pit Bull owners who refuse to be responsible pet owners.

I should also point out that this is not just a Pit Bull issue. Similar problems can evolve in many breeds of dogs.

I have never owned a Pit but over the years I have been around a lot of them. In the past 35 years I have seen some very nicePit Bullat training seminars that I have attended or sponsored. Many are really cool dogs. Unfortunately many others become rank dangerous animals mostly because their owners have never established pack structure with their dogs.

This is a breed of dog that requires a solid foundation in pack structure. When irresponsible owners ignore pack behavior, rank drive issues and obedience training their dogs often become dangerous animals.

The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ention examined U.S. dog-attack fatalities from 1979 to 1998. During that period, dogs killed more than 300 Americans, and pit bulls, either purebred or crossbred, accounted for 76 of the deaths, the most of any breed. Purebred or crossbred Rottweillers were responsible for 44 deaths, the second highest. The CDC concluded that Rottweillers and pit bulls were responsible for 67 percent of fatal attacks.

I breed German Shepherds and Malinois, for various reasons I don't believe "everyone who wants a dog" should own one of our dogs, the same does for PB. The purpose for writing and maintaining this article is to hopefully convince potential owners to think before they buy a PB. This is not a breed to jump into without a game plan. If you are not sure of you want to do the training then don't get a Pit Bull.

As a general rule PBs that attack humans are not born with the instinct to kill a human. They get that way because their owners fail them. They get that way because owners:

1- DON'T ESTABLISH PACK STRUCTURE

2- THEY DON'T TRAIN THEIR DOGS

3- THEY DON'T CONTROL THE ENVIRONMENT THE DOGS ARE ALLOWED

4- THEY DON'T PROPERLY SOCIALIZE THEIR DOGS

As a working breed, PBs were originally bred as fighting dogs. With most working breeds the majority of the dogs that are sold today have had the working ability bred out of them. Unfortunately because of ass holes like Michael Vick, this is not the case with PBs. But with this said that does not mean that PB's cannot be molded into safe well mannered family pets - they can be.
